North Fort Myers motorcyclist remains in hospital following crash
A motorcyclist remained hospitalized Tuesday after he and a Cape Coral driver collided.
Matthew Brethauer, 25, of North Fort Myers, was listed in critical condition at Lee Memorial Hospital, where he was taken Sunday following the accident on Bayshore Road, according to officials.
The Florida Highway Patrol reported that Brethauer was headed west on a Harley-Davidson Sport. He was traveling behind a Hyundai Elantra, driven by Kelly Driskell, 35, of the Cape. As they approached the intersection of U.S. 41, Brethauer accelerated into the right lane at about 3:16 p.m.
Driskell then changed lanes into the right lane, according to the FHP. As a result, the left side of the motorcycle collided with the right rear corner of the Hyundai. Both vehicles came to a final stop.
Brethauer was transported to the hospital with critical injuries. He was not wearing a helmet.
The FHP reported that Driskell was not injured in the accident, nor was her passenger, Nathaniel Driskell, 8, also of the Cape. Both Driskell and the child were wearing seat belts at the time.
An improper change of lane was cited as the cause of the crash, according to officials.
